What Techniques Do the Best Carpet Cleaning Companies Use to Effectively Remove Pet Stains?
The best carpet cleaning companies employ several effective techniques to remove pet stains and odors from carpets.
- Hot Water Extraction: This method, often referred to as steam cleaning, involves injecting hot water mixed with cleaning solutions deep into the carpet fibers. The high temperature helps to break down stains and odors, while the powerful vacuum extracts the water along with the dirt and pet waste, leaving carpets clean and fresh.
- Encapsulation Cleaning: In this technique, a cleaning solution is applied to the carpet that crystallizes around dirt and stains as it dries. Once dry, the encapsulated particles can be easily vacuumed away, making this method effective for quick clean-ups and regular maintenance, particularly in high-traffic areas.
- Carpet Shampooing: This traditional method uses a foamy shampoo that is applied to the carpet and scrubbed in with a machine. While it can effectively remove dirt and some pet stains, it may leave behind residues if not rinsed thoroughly, which can attract dirt in the future.
- Odor Neutralization: Many carpet cleaning companies utilize specialized products designed to neutralize pet odors instead of just masking them. These products break down the compounds causing the odors, ensuring a more thorough and lasting solution for homes with pets.
- Pre-Treatment Solutions: Before deep cleaning, the best carpet cleaning companies often apply a pre-treatment solution specifically targeted at pet stains. This solution works on breaking down the stain’s structure, making it easier to remove during the main cleaning process.
- Bio-Enzymatic Cleaners: These cleaners contain natural enzymes that specifically target and break down organic stains and odors caused by pets. They are particularly effective for urine stains, as they eliminate the source of the odor rather than just masking it, leading to a more thorough clean.

What Can You Expect from a Professional Carpet Cleaning Service Specializing in Pet Stains?
When you hire a professional carpet cleaning service that specializes in pet stains, expect a thorough and effective approach tailored to your needs. Here’s what typically happens during the process:
-
Initial Assessment: Technicians will evaluate the extent of the stains and odors. They will identify the type of carpet fibers and the nature of the stains to choose the appropriate cleaning method.
-
Pre-Treatment: Stains are pre-treated with specialized solutions designed to break down the chemical compounds in pet urine or feces. This step ensures that the stain is driven out more effectively.
-
Deep Cleaning: Using advanced equipment, professionals will perform deep extraction cleaning, which may involve hot water extraction or steam cleaning. This method penetrates deep into carpet fibers and padding, effectively removing stains and odors.
-
Spot Treatment: Persistent stains may receive additional spot treatments with concentrated solutions to ensure complete removal, along with techniques like scrubbing or agitation.
-
Deodorization: After cleaning, a deodorizing agent is often applied to neutralize any lingering odors, leaving your carpets smelling fresh.
-
Protective Coating: Some companies may offer a post-cleaning protective coating to help resist future stains.
Overall, working with specialized services ensures not just clean carpets but also a healthier home environment.

What Additional Services Can Carpet Cleaning Companies Offer for Pet Owners?
Carpet cleaning companies often offer specialized services tailored to the needs of pet owners, ensuring a cleaner and healthier living environment.
- Stain Removal Treatments: Many carpet cleaning companies provide specialized stain removal treatments designed specifically for pet stains, such as urine, feces, and vomit. These treatments typically use enzymatic cleaners that break down the organic compounds in pet waste, effectively eliminating both the stain and odor.
- Deodorization Services: Apart from removing visible stains, carpet cleaning companies often include deodorization services to neutralize odors left by pets. This process may involve applying a deodorizing solution or using advanced equipment like ozone generators to eliminate persistent smells and leave carpets smelling fresh.
- Deep Cleaning Methods: Some companies offer deep cleaning methods such as hot water extraction, which is particularly effective for pet owners. This technique involves injecting hot water and cleaning solution into the carpet fibers, then extracting it along with dirt, allergens, and pet dander, resulting in a more thorough clean.
- Pet-Safe Cleaning Products: Pet owners may have concerns about using harsh chemicals in their homes, so many carpet cleaning companies offer pet-safe cleaning products. These eco-friendly options are specifically formulated to be non-toxic, ensuring the safety of pets while still providing effective cleaning results.
- Carpet Protection Treatments: To prevent future stains and make cleaning easier, some carpet cleaning services provide carpet protection treatments. These treatments create a protective barrier around the carpet fibers, helping to repel liquids and stains, and making it easier to clean up after pets.
- Upholstery Cleaning: In addition to carpets, many companies also offer upholstery cleaning services for furniture that pets may use. This ensures that all areas where pets frequent, including sofas and chairs, are also kept clean and free from pet hair, dander, and odors.
- Area Rug Cleaning: For pet owners with area rugs, specialized cleaning services may be available to ensure these items are properly maintained. This can include techniques like hand washing or gentle cleaning methods tailored to the specific materials of the rug.
What Steps Should You Take to Prepare Your Home for a Carpet Cleaning Appointment Focused on Pet Stains?
Preparing your home for a carpet cleaning appointment, especially for pet stains, involves several key steps to ensure the best results.
- Remove Furniture: Clear the area of any furniture or movable items to give the cleaning professionals ample space to work.
- Vacuum Thoroughly: Vacuum the carpets thoroughly to remove loose dirt, hair, and debris, which can help the cleaning solution penetrate better.
- Identify Stains: Clearly mark or point out the specific areas with pet stains to ensure that the cleaning team focuses on those spots.
- Pre-treat Stains: If possible, pre-treat the stains with a pet stain remover to help break down the odors and residues before the professionals arrive.
- Secure Pets: Ensure that your pets are in a safe area away from the cleaning process to prevent them from interfering or getting stressed by the equipment.
- Communicate Special Needs: Inform the cleaning company of any particular concerns or special needs regarding your pets or the types of stains present.
Removing furniture allows the cleaners to access every part of the carpet and ensures that no areas are overlooked during the cleaning process. It also prevents any risk of damage to your furniture or the newly cleaned carpets.
Vacuuming thoroughly is crucial as it lifts out loose dirt and pet hair, which can otherwise interfere with the effectiveness of the cleaning solution. A good vacuuming helps in achieving a more profound clean as it allows the solution to work on embedded stains and odors.
Identifying stains is essential, as it helps the cleaning team to prioritize their efforts and apply specific treatments to the most problematic areas. Clear communication about where the stains are located can lead to better results and a more satisfactory cleaning job.
Pre-treating stains with a suitable product before the appointment can significantly enhance the cleaning efficacy by loosening the stain’s grip on the carpet fibers. This step can save time and ensure that the stains are thoroughly addressed during the professional clean.
Securing pets during the cleaning process is vital for the safety of both the animals and the cleaners. It prevents pets from becoming anxious or potentially obstructing the cleaning work, ensuring that the appointment goes smoothly.
Communicating any special needs allows the cleaning company to tailor their approach to your specific situation, taking into account any allergies, sensitivities, or specific cleaning products that may be necessary. This ensures the best possible outcome and satisfaction with the cleaning service provided.
